Northrop Grumman Space Systems is seeking a Senior Principal Circuit Design Engineer to join the Flight Systems Team. This position is located in Roy, UT and supports the Ground Based Strategic Deterrent (GBSD) program. A competitive relocation package may be included with offer.

What You’ll Get To Do:

The selected candidate will fill the role of Guidance Computer Actuator Motor Drive Design Engineer joining our team of qualified, diverse individuals. The individual in this role will develop Analog board designs utilized in the Guidance Computer (GC) flight Unit.  The GC is a high reliability, radiation hardened flight controller for the Sentinel Aerospace Vehicle (AVE).  The Sentinel Guidance Computer contains digital processing, digital I/O, and analog actuator/power I/O electronics functions.  The scope of this role includes collaboration with systems engineers, mechanical engineers, manufacturing engineers, and other electrical engineers to perform design trades and requirements flow down, to create interconnection drawings, to perform electrical analysis, to develop test plans, and ultimately to deliver working hardware that meets program requirements. The qualified candidate will be an experienced actuator drive board design engineer who will work on the actuator drive board design and development with application in an embedded control processing function.  This position reports directly to the Guidance Computer Responsible Design Engineer (RDE).
